Transaction 856007489bf6236332f131528ce980d4835540b5da09db9d5790c25ed176a12f
1 Input
1 Output
-
856007489bf6236332f131528ce980d4835540b5da09db9d5790c25ed176a12f:0
- value
- 842658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d357053e771a1ec54952596351985ae2dc8c7ca7 OP_EQUAL
- address
- 3LxUkJtVUrNKes8N6jXr74zdtaPeYehyQD